Why Is Las Vegas Called Sin City?

Las Vegas is the most popular city in Nevada and is famously known as “Sin City.” It is a major tourist destination, and has a well-deserved reputation for being a hub of gambling, debauchery, and over-the-top hedonism. But why is it called Sin City?

The moniker “Sin City” comes from the city’s anything-goes reputation. Las Vegas is home to numerous casinos, nightclubs, adult entertainment venues, and other attractions that make it a haven for those looking to indulge in their wildest desires. The city has long been a destination for people looking to gamble, enjoy the nightlife, or simply let loose.

The phrase “What happens in Vegas stays in Vegas” is a popular saying that reflects the city’s reputation. Las Vegas is known for its lax laws and regulations, allowing visitors to get away with behaviors they wouldn’t be able to indulge in elsewhere. This has been a draw for tourists and locals for decades, and has helped cement the city’s image as Sin City.

Las Vegas is also home to many of the world’s most famous casinos, from the Bellagio and Caesars Palace to the MGM Grand and the Venetian. These casinos offer a variety of gaming options, from slots and table games to poker and sports betting. All of these activities are legal in Nevada and help contribute to the city’s reputation as Sin City.

Las Vegas also has a thriving nightlife scene, with numerous nightclubs, bars, and adult entertainment venues scattered throughout the city. This means that visitors can find whatever they’re looking for, whether they’re looking for a quiet night out or a wild night of partying. The city’s reputation as a destination for hedonistic activities is only strengthened by the presence of these venues.

Las Vegas’s reputation as Sin City has been a draw for tourists for years. Although gambling and partying can be dangerous, it is one of the only places in the world where such activities are legal. For those who want to indulge in their wildest desires, Las Vegas is the perfect destination.
